注册 登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

《电脑之家》

请点击:“日志”浏览电脑知识

 
 
 

日志

 
 

最小播放器(纯代码制作)  

2012-04-01 22:03:37|  分类: 最小播放器(纯代 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|

该播放器用AS纯代码写成,代码如下:

var mc_x:Number =50;//设置mc变量 x、y位置
var mc_y:Number =50;
fscommand("fullscreen", false);
fscommand("allowscale", false);
fscommand("showmenu", false);
//加载外部声音
my_sound = new Sound();
my_sound.loadSound("http://www.xdyx.net/news/uploadfile/200812108431833.mp3", true);
my_sound.start();
//循环播放
my_sound.onSoundComplete = function() {
my_sound.start();
};
//创建播放按钮
this.createEmptyMovieClip("play_mc", 1);
with (play_mc) {
beginFill(0x008800); //设置播放按钮▲颜色、大小;
moveTo(mc_x+2, mc_y);
lineTo(mc_x+11,mc_y+4.5);
lineTo(mc_x+2, mc_y+9);
lineTo(mc_x+2, mc_y);
endFill();
}
play_mc.onRelease = function() {
my_sound.start(time);
this._visible = 0;
pause_mc._visible = 1;
};
//创建暂停按钮
this.createEmptyMovieClip("pause_mc", 2);
with (pause_mc) {
beginFill(0x008800); //设置暂停方框、充填色;
moveTo(mc_x+2, mc_y);
lineTo(mc_x+11, mc_y);
lineTo(mc_x+11, mc_y+9);
lineTo(mc_x+2, mc_y+9);
lineTo(mc_x+2, mc_y);
endFill();
beginFill(0xFF0000);//暂停时“|”、充填颜色;
moveTo(mc_x+5, mc_y);
lineTo(mc_x+8, mc_y);
lineTo(mc_x+8, mc_y+9);
lineTo(mc_x+5, mc_y+9);
lineTo(mc_x+5, mc_y);
endFill();
}
pause_mc.onRelease = function() {
this._visible = 0;
play_mc._visible = 1;
my_sound.stop();
time = my_sound.position/1000;
};
该播放器与2011-05-31上传到自己的网站: 进入网站欣赏

  评论这张
 
阅读(361)| 评论(14)
推荐 转载

历史上的今天

在LOFTER的更多文章

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2017